"Bioware has said recently that they are considering all fan feedback, positive and negative.
I don't actually know anything about their actual plans (and I couldn't say anything if I did), but I do know that there will be upcoming DLC. Changing or expanding the end of the game wouldn't be unprecedented.
The gaming community saw it a few years ago with Fallout 3 from Bethesda and the Broken Steel DLC.
I really enjoyed Fallout 3, and didn't really have a problem with its ending, but was thrilled to get the Broken Steel disc.
Obviously, if Bioware wants to record more dialogue, I'd be there. I'm definitely scheduled to record more dialogue for DLC, but at this stage, I don't know what that will entail."
